Mountain biking around Villebernier offers a diverse landscape characterized by the Loire River valley, historical sites, and unique geological formations. The region features a mix of riverside paths, gravel trails, and routes passing by notable landmarks such as Saumur Castle and ancient troglodyte houses. Terrain generally includes gentle ascents and descents, making it suitable for various skill levels.

Between the Loire and the hills, Turquant welcomes, in season, craftsmen and a Métiers d'Art boutique in a remarkably restored troglodyte site. Several designers open their workshops to the public and passionately share their expertise. Today, you can wander around the troglodytes between tradition and modernity to discover all their originality.

Between Montsoreau and Saumur, the tuffeau rock dominates the Loire and is cut from one end to the other by a series of caves, sometimes troglodyte dwellings, sometimes quarries... Villages spring up in the valleys that crisscross the hills, while vineyards and mills mark the ridge. In Turquant, more than anywhere else, you can discover this Loire landscape, so characteristic of the Côte Saumuroise. Today, between tradition and modernity, the troglodytes can be discovered in all their originality, particularly in the Village des Métiers d'Art.

At this location you are in the middle of an underground labyrinth of Souzay-Champigny. Explanation: underground, in the cliffs and hills, the troglodytes of Saumurois form an enormous underground network. These are unique in France. More than 1 km of tunnels have been dug by man over the centuries to live, shelter and work. Here you can literally dive into a cool past.

There are over 100 mountain bike trails around Villebernier, offering a wide range of options for different skill levels and preferences. The komoot community has explored these routes over 1100 times.
The terrain around Villebernier is diverse, featuring riverside paths along the Loire River, gravel trails, and routes that pass by historical sites. You'll encounter generally gentle ascents and descents, making it suitable for various skill levels.
Yes, Villebernier offers 34 easy mountain bike trails perfect for beginners or those looking for a relaxed ride. These routes typically feature gentle gradients and well-maintained paths.
For experienced riders seeking a challenge, there are 9 difficult mountain bike trails around Villebernier. These routes often include more technical sections or steeper climbs, providing a more demanding experience.
Many mountain bike trails in Villebernier pass by significant historical landmarks. You can explore routes that lead to impressive sites like Château de Saumur, ancient troglodyte houses such as the Souzay-Champigny troglodyte site, and other castles like Montsoreau Castle.
Yes, many mountain bike routes around Villebernier are circular, allowing you to start and end at the same point. Examples include the Saumur Castle – Étang de Joreau loop from Souzay-Champigny and the Troglodyte houses – Saumur Castle loop from Souzay-Champigny.
Mountain bike trails in Villebernier vary in length. For instance, the Troglodyte houses – Saumur Castle loop from Souzay-Champigny is about 14.9 miles (24.0 km), while the Saumur Castle – Troglodyte houses loop from Saumur covers approximately 29.0 miles (46.6 km).
The mountain biking experience in Villebernier is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.5 stars from nearly 200 reviews. Reviewers often praise the scenic river paths, the blend of historical exploration with natural beauty, and the variety of routes catering to different skill levels.
The Loire Valley region, including Villebernier, is generally pleasant for mountain biking from spring through autumn. Spring offers blooming landscapes, while autumn provides beautiful foliage. Summers are typically warm, making early mornings or late afternoons ideal for rides.
Yes, with 34 easy trails and many routes featuring gentle terrain, Villebernier is a great destination for family-friendly mountain biking. Look for routes along the riverside or those with minimal elevation gain for a comfortable family outing.
While specific public transport connections to trailheads can vary, Saumur, a major town near Villebernier, serves as a regional transport hub. Many trails are accessible from Saumur, which has train and bus services. It's advisable to check local transport schedules for the most up-to-date information.
Parking is generally available in and around the starting points of many trails, particularly in towns like Saumur or Souzay-Champigny. Look for designated parking areas near popular attractions or village centers, which often serve as convenient access points for routes.
